Mundra’s Nov coking coal imports dip 47% m-o-m
21 Dec 2015
India Coal Market Watch
December 21: Coking coal imports through the port of Mundra decreased 47.28% to 47,967 tons in November 2015 from 91,000 tons in October 2015, as per provisional information available with ICMW.
In November 2014, coking coal imports via Mundra Port had stood at 202,586 tons.
For the first eight (April-November) of the current fiscal (2015-16), coking coal imports through Mundra Port decreased 16.89% to 637,521 tons against 767,152 tons imported in the same period of the previous fiscal.

In November 2015, a volume of 32,967 tons of the material came in from Australia at a price range of Rs 5,986-Rs 6,754 ($90-$102) per ton and 15,000 tons from Mozambique at a price range of Rs 4,367-Rs 4,423 ($67) per ton.
In October, a volume of 72,000 tons of the material came in from Australia at a price range of Rs 5,865-Rs 6,749 ($90-$102) per ton and 19,000 tons from Mozambique at a price range of Rs 4,320-Rs 6,358 ($67-$95) per ton.
